The global markets this week is primarily driven by the massive expansion of artificial intelligence infrastructure through strategic partnerships and nuclear energy investments. Significant shifts in the semiconductor and critical minerals sectors as nations like Japan and the U.S. strive for technological independence from China. Economic instability is also a major theme, evidenced by rising inflation due to Middle Eastern tensions and mounting defaults in the American private credit and commercial real estate markets. Corporate maneuvering remains active, featuring multi-billion dollar mergers in deep-sea mining, legal settlements involving the opioid crisis, and a hostile bid to take Universal Music Group private.
